无法将日期因子转换为日期时间

时间:2019-06-01 18:55:09

标签: r dpl

我导入了带有日期的txt文件,其格式为1/25/2019 2:15:19 PM。如何将其转换为1-25-2019 2:15:19的数字日期

我用过

$remain_fee = \DB::table('remaining_bus_fees')
    ->whereMonth('date', '=', Carbon::now()->subMonth()->month)
    ->whereStudentId(2)->get();

1 个答案:

答案 0 :(得分:0)

使用%I表示小时,使用%p表示上午/下午:

as.POSIXct(factor("1/25/2019 2:15:19 PM"), format = "%m/%d/%Y %I:%M:%S %p")
## [1] "2019-01-25 14:15:19 EST"

有关更多信息,请参见?strptime